native/umya_native/src/page_breaks.rs
use crate::atoms;
use crate::UmyaSpreadsheet;
use rustler::{Atom, Error as NifError, NifResult, ResourceArc};
use umya_spreadsheet::Break;
/// Add a row page break at the specified row number.
#[rustler::nif]
pub fn add_row_page_break(
spreadsheet: ResourceArc<UmyaSpreadsheet>,
sheet_name: String,
row_number: u32,
manual: bool,
) -> NifResult<Atom> {
let result = std::panic::catch_unwind(|| {
let mut workbook = spreadsheet.spreadsheet.lock().unwrap();
if let Some(worksheet) = workbook.get_sheet_by_name_mut(&sheet_name) {
let mut page_break = Break::default();
page_break.set_id(row_number);
page_break.set_manual_page_break(manual);
worksheet.get_row_breaks_mut().add_break_list(page_break);
Ok(atoms::ok())
} else {
Err(NifError::Term(Box::new((
atoms::error(),
"sheet_not_found".to_string(),
))))
}
});
match result {
Ok(r) => r,
Err(_) => Err(NifError::Term(Box::new((
atoms::error(),
"unknown_error".to_string(),
)))),
}
}
/// Add a column page break at the specified column number.
#[rustler::nif]
pub fn add_column_page_break(
spreadsheet: ResourceArc<UmyaSpreadsheet>,
sheet_name: String,
column_number: u32,
manual: bool,
) -> NifResult<Atom> {
let result = std::panic::catch_unwind(|| {
let mut workbook = spreadsheet.spreadsheet.lock().unwrap();
if let Some(worksheet) = workbook.get_sheet_by_name_mut(&sheet_name) {
let mut page_break = Break::default();
page_break.set_id(column_number);
page_break.set_manual_page_break(manual);
worksheet.get_column_breaks_mut().add_break_list(page_break);
Ok(atoms::ok())
} else {
Err(NifError::Term(Box::new((
atoms::error(),
"sheet_not_found".to_string(),
))))
}
});
match result {
Ok(r) => r,
Err(_) => Err(NifError::Term(Box::new((
atoms::error(),
"unknown_error".to_string(),
)))),
}
}
/// Remove a row page break at the specified row number.
#[rustler::nif]
pub fn remove_row_page_break(
spreadsheet: ResourceArc<UmyaSpreadsheet>,
sheet_name: String,
row_number: u32,
) -> NifResult<Atom> {
let result = std::panic::catch_unwind(|| {
let mut workbook = spreadsheet.spreadsheet.lock().unwrap();
if let Some(worksheet) = workbook.get_sheet_by_name_mut(&sheet_name) {
let row_breaks = worksheet.get_row_breaks_mut();
let break_list = row_breaks.get_break_list_mut();
break_list.retain(|page_break| *page_break.get_id() != row_number);
Ok(atoms::ok())
} else {
Err(NifError::Term(Box::new((
atoms::error(),
"sheet_not_found".to_string(),
))))
}
});
match result {
Ok(r) => r,
Err(_) => Err(NifError::Term(Box::new((
atoms::error(),
"unknown_error".to_string(),
)))),
}
}
/// Remove a column page break at the specified column number.
#[rustler::nif]
pub fn remove_column_page_break(
spreadsheet: ResourceArc<UmyaSpreadsheet>,
sheet_name: String,
column_number: u32,
) -> NifResult<Atom> {
let result = std::panic::catch_unwind(|| {
let mut workbook = spreadsheet.spreadsheet.lock().unwrap();
if let Some(worksheet) = workbook.get_sheet_by_name_mut(&sheet_name) {
let column_breaks = worksheet.get_column_breaks_mut();
let break_list = column_breaks.get_break_list_mut();
break_list.retain(|page_break| *page_break.get_id() != column_number);
Ok(atoms::ok())
} else {
Err(NifError::Term(Box::new((
atoms::error(),
"sheet_not_found".to_string(),
))))
}
});
match result {
Ok(r) => r,
Err(_) => Err(NifError::Term(Box::new((
atoms::error(),
"unknown_error".to_string(),
)))),
}
}
/// Get all row page breaks for the specified sheet.
#[rustler::nif]
pub fn get_row_page_breaks(
spreadsheet: ResourceArc<UmyaSpreadsheet>,
sheet_name: String,
) -> NifResult<Vec<(u32, bool)>> {
let mut workbook = spreadsheet.spreadsheet.lock().unwrap();
if let Some(worksheet) = workbook.get_sheet_by_name_mut(&sheet_name) {
let row_breaks = worksheet.get_row_breaks();
let breaks: Vec<(u32, bool)> = row_breaks
.get_break_list()
.iter()
.map(|page_break| (*page_break.get_id(), *page_break.get_manual_page_break()))
.collect();
Ok(breaks)
} else {
Err(NifError::Term(Box::new((
atoms::error(),
"sheet_not_found".to_string(),
))))
}
}
/// Get all column page breaks for the specified sheet.
#[rustler::nif]
pub fn get_column_page_breaks(
spreadsheet: ResourceArc<UmyaSpreadsheet>,
sheet_name: String,
) -> NifResult<Vec<(u32, bool)>> {
let mut workbook = spreadsheet.spreadsheet.lock().unwrap();
if let Some(worksheet) = workbook.get_sheet_by_name_mut(&sheet_name) {
let column_breaks = worksheet.get_column_breaks();
let breaks: Vec<(u32, bool)> = column_breaks
.get_break_list()
.iter()
.map(|page_break| (*page_break.get_id(), *page_break.get_manual_page_break()))
.collect();
Ok(breaks)
} else {
Err(NifError::Term(Box::new((
atoms::error(),
"sheet_not_found".to_string(),
))))
}
}
/// Clear all row page breaks for the specified sheet.
#[rustler::nif]
pub fn clear_row_page_breaks(
spreadsheet: ResourceArc<UmyaSpreadsheet>,
sheet_name: String,
) -> NifResult<Atom> {
let result = std::panic::catch_unwind(|| {
let mut workbook = spreadsheet.spreadsheet.lock().unwrap();
if let Some(worksheet) = workbook.get_sheet_by_name_mut(&sheet_name) {
let row_breaks = worksheet.get_row_breaks_mut();
row_breaks.get_break_list_mut().clear();
Ok(atoms::ok())
} else {
Err(NifError::Term(Box::new((
atoms::error(),
"sheet_not_found".to_string(),
))))
}
});
match result {
Ok(r) => r,
Err(_) => Err(NifError::Term(Box::new((
atoms::error(),
"unknown_error".to_string(),
)))),
}
}
/// Clear all column page breaks for the specified sheet.
#[rustler::nif]
pub fn clear_column_page_breaks(
spreadsheet: ResourceArc<UmyaSpreadsheet>,
sheet_name: String,
) -> NifResult<Atom> {
let result = std::panic::catch_unwind(|| {
let mut workbook = spreadsheet.spreadsheet.lock().unwrap();
if let Some(worksheet) = workbook.get_sheet_by_name_mut(&sheet_name) {
let column_breaks = worksheet.get_column_breaks_mut();
column_breaks.get_break_list_mut().clear();
Ok(atoms::ok())
} else {
Err(NifError::Term(Box::new((
atoms::error(),
"sheet_not_found".to_string(),
))))
}
});
match result {
Ok(r) => r,
Err(_) => Err(NifError::Term(Box::new((
atoms::error(),
"unknown_error".to_string(),
)))),
}
}
/// Check if a row page break exists at the specified row number.
#[rustler::nif]
pub fn has_row_page_break(
spreadsheet: ResourceArc<UmyaSpreadsheet>,
sheet_name: String,
row_number: u32,
) -> NifResult<bool> {
let mut workbook = spreadsheet.spreadsheet.lock().unwrap();
if let Some(worksheet) = workbook.get_sheet_by_name_mut(&sheet_name) {
let row_breaks = worksheet.get_row_breaks();
let has_break = row_breaks
.get_break_list()
.iter()
.any(|page_break| *page_break.get_id() == row_number);
Ok(has_break)
} else {
Err(NifError::Term(Box::new((
atoms::error(),
"sheet_not_found".to_string(),
))))
}
}
/// Check if a column page break exists at the specified column number.
#[rustler::nif]
pub fn has_column_page_break(
spreadsheet: ResourceArc<UmyaSpreadsheet>,
sheet_name: String,
column_number: u32,
) -> NifResult<bool> {
let mut workbook = spreadsheet.spreadsheet.lock().unwrap();
if let Some(worksheet) = workbook.get_sheet_by_name_mut(&sheet_name) {
let column_breaks = worksheet.get_column_breaks();
let has_break = column_breaks
.get_break_list()
.iter()
.any(|page_break| *page_break.get_id() == column_number);
Ok(has_break)
} else {
Err(NifError::Term(Box::new((
atoms::error(),
"sheet_not_found".to_string(),
))))
}
}
